Output 3258f3e08380dbd2e5586e5ed53b0602f7cc6632d6eabae9d3831a37cfb70035:62

value
32535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b5f3f812e650a7b90f6c43f5af957c565da99e OP_EQUAL
address
3QuoXatKP1AMLP5xsLfGfS1VRVHmdWqDTv
transaction
3258f3e08380dbd2e5586e5ed53b0602f7cc6632d6eabae9d3831a37cfb70035
spent
true